Currently Cluster API assumes that it can initiate direct connections to all child clusters and/or to an infrastructure control plane. For some users / usage scenarios this isn't possible (technically or by policy) and so this group will investigate alternatives to enable these types of usage scenarios. 20 21 ## User Story and Problem Statement 22 23 From [discussion](https://github.com/kubernetes-sigs/cluster-api/issues/6520#issuecomment-1341517675) this group will consider 3 uses cases: 24 25 1. A solution for managed clusters only, which does not require API-server connectivity from CAPI at all. 26 1. The "common cluster as a service offering" scenario where only the workload clusters' worker nodes are in a different network. 27 1. The scenario where a management cluster manages workload clusters (including control plane nodes), which are in a different network than the management cluster. 28 29 > Although use case 3 will likely be the main focus. 30 31 ## Scope 32 33 The scope of this group will be the following: 34 35 1.
